    Class KHRSimpleControllerProfile.KHRSimpleController

    An Input System device based off the Khronos Simple Controller interaction profile. This device contains one haptic output motor.

    Namespace: UnityEngine.XR.OpenXR.Features.Interactions
    Assembly: solution.dll
    Syntax
    [Preserve]
    [InputControlLayout(displayName = "Khronos Simple Controller (OpenXR)", commonUsages = new string[] { "LeftHand", "RightHand" })]
    public class KHRSimpleControllerProfile.KHRSimpleController : XRControllerWithRumble

    Properties

    Name Description
    devicePose

    A PoseControl that represents information from the grip OpenXR binding.

    devicePosition

    A Vector3Control required for backwards compatibility with the XRSDK layouts. This is the device position, or grip position. This value is equivalent to mapping devicePose/position.

    deviceRotation

    A QuaternionControl required for backwards compatibility with the XRSDK layouts. This is the device orientation, or grip orientation. This value is equivalent to mapping devicePose/rotation.

    haptic

    A HapticControl that represents the haptic binding.

    isTracked

    A ButtonControl required for backwards compatibility with the XRSDK layouts. This represents the overall tracking state of the device. This value is equivalent to mapping devicePose/isTracked.

    menu

    A ButtonControl that represents the menu OpenXR binding.

    pointer

    A PoseControl that represents information from the aim OpenXR binding.

    pointerPosition

    A Vector3Control required for backwards compatibility with the XRSDK layouts. This is the pointer position. This value is equivalent to mapping pointerPose/position.

    pointerRotation

    A QuaternionControl required for backwards compatibility with the XRSDK layouts. This is the pointer rotation. This value is equivalent to mapping pointerPose/rotation.

    select

    A ButtonControl that represents the select OpenXR binding.

    trackingState

    A IntegerControl required for backwards compatibility with the XRSDK layouts. This represents the bit flag set indicating what data is valid. This value is equivalent to mapping devicePose/trackingState.
